Fisherman's
Bouillabaisse
1/4 cup olive oil
2 garlic cloves, crushed
4 cups water
1/2 cup white wine
1 package dry onion soup mix
1 tablespoon chopped flat-leaf parsley
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 (14.5-ounce) can whole tomatoes, chopped
1 1/2 pounds lobster tails
1 pound cod
6 whole clams
6 whole mussels
- In large saucepan heat olive oil over
medium heat and cook crushed garlic cloves until golden. Add
water, white wine, dry onion soup mix, chopped parsley, and thyme.
Blend thoroughly. Stir in chopped whole tomatoes. Bring mixture
to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er covered for 15 minutes.
- To the saucepan mixture add lobster tails
and cut-up cod; simmer for 10 minutes. Add whole clams and whole
mussels and simmer an additional 5 minutes, or until the mussels
open. Discard any unopened shells. Serve.
Makes 5 servings.
